Lyra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:LYRA – Get Free Report) major shareholder Perceptive Advisors Llc sold 19,739 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Friday, November 7th. The shares were sold at an average price of $4.75, for a total value of $93,760.25.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ider directly owned 20,528 shares in the company, valued at approximately $97,508. This represents a 49.02% decrease in their position. Major shareholders that own at least 10% of a company’s stock are required to disclose their sales and purchases with the SEC.
Perceptive Advisors Llc also recently made the following trade(s):
- On Monday, November 10th, Perceptive Advisors Llc sold 18,502 shares of Lyra Therapeutics st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$4.54, for a total value of $83,999.08.
- On Thursday, November 6th, Perceptive Advisors Llc sold 32,149 shares of Lyra Therapeutics st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$5.18, for a total transaction of $166,531.82.

About Lyra Therapeutics
Lyra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ical-stage biotechnology company, focuses on the development and commercialization of novel integrated drug and delivery solutions for the localized treatment of patients with ear, nose, and throat diseases. It's XTreo technology platform is designed to deliver medicines directly to the affected tissue for sustained periods with a single administration.
